Fixing Surface Scratches
Tidy the Local Window Repair Technician: Use a glass cleaner and a microfiber cloth to remove dust and grime. This prevents more scratches during the repair procedure.
Use Glass Polish: Dampen a clean microfiber cloth with glass polish. Rub the polish into the scratched location in a circular movement for about 30 seconds.
Buff to Shine: Wipe off any excess polish with a tidy fabric. Repeat the procedure if necessary till the scratch is less noticeable.
Repairing Deep Scratches and Gouges
Evaluate the Damage: Determine if the scratch is unfathomable to repair. If the scratch has compromised the stability of the glass, you ought to think about replacing the pane.
Sand the Area: For deep scratches, utilize fine-grit sandpaper. Gently sand the area around the scratch to smooth out any bumps. Be careful not to over-sand, which might increase the size of the scratch.
Use Cerium Oxide: Mix cerium oxide powder with water to form a paste. Utilize a microfiber fabric to apply this mix to the scratch and enthusiast it out, comparable to the procedure for surface scratches.
Fill with Clear Epoxy (if essential): If the scratch is a gouge, you may require to fill it with clear epoxy or resin. Follow the maker's directions carefully for the very best results.
Final Cleaning: Once the repair is total, clean the Double Glazed Window Repair thoroughly to get rid of any residues from the repair products.

A1: Most surface scratches can be repaired at home with the right techniques. Nevertheless, deep scratches or serious gouges might need professional assistance or perhaps replacement.
Q2: Is glass polish effective for all kinds of glass?
A2: Glass polish is most efficient on hard glass surfaces. Constantly test on a small area first to guarantee compatibility.
Q3: How long does the repair procedure take?
A3: Repairing minor scratches can take simply a couple of minutes, whereas deeper scratches might need more time, specifically if sanding and filling are required.
Q4: Are there any DIY repair sets available?
A4: Yes, many merchants use DIY glass repair kits that consist of the required products and guidelines for typical types of scratches.
Q5: What should I do if the scratch is unfathomable?
A5: If you figure out that the scratch has actually compromised the glass's stability, it's best to speak with a professional for a replacement or specialized repair.
